Output 151fd6802dc95cb1db1a3c81e7b686d3e0145e867e04d6c2fdf6ec1ade475bd3:0

value
876811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 308c1c4993156d0b7ce905ed4ce16b3254be31fe OP_EQUAL
address
367iCoLJZ114NEkwyFujwTnSUJeSefpbDo
transaction
151fd6802dc95cb1db1a3c81e7b686d3e0145e867e04d6c2fdf6ec1ade475bd3
spent
true